On May 6, 2005, at 10:41 AM, Rob Savoye wrote:
Josh Conner wrote:
Adding support for the program_transform_name (sed-style expression
to convert the names of executables under test) would simplify the
testing of gcc cross-compilers, since the runtest.exp procedure
"transform" is unable to find binaries created with a transformed
name.
I'd hate to make a major change like this without asking the GCC
team what they think, as it'll impact anyway doing cross testing.
Maybe the transform proc should work correctly. It works the way it is
for most people, so I'm curious whay this hasn't been noticed before.
Are you installng your cross tools with a non-standard name ?
Actually, it shouldn't impact anyone unless they set the variable
$program_transform_name, e.g., in site.exp (ideally, automatically by
gcc -- I have another patch for this). So, there shouldn't be any
regression issues.
I expect this hasn't been noticed before because the
program-transform-name used by gcc probably matches the target-alias
for many cross-compilation environments. Of course, this is just
speculation on my part, but it is the only way that the scripts appear
to work for transformed names.
